Hi all, I have a question
I created a flow that creates item in a list from submitted form.
Is it possible to setup the flow to create item in different list base on form submitter's department? (department field in AD)
For example:
There is a payment request form. John is marketing department, and Peter is sales department
When john submit the payment request form
Flow creates an item in "Marketing department payment request list"
When peter submit the payment request form
Flow creates an item in the "Sales department payment request list"
If yes, how?
If, not then, of course I can just create 2 forms and 2 flows.

@RandolphLES @jonlake rather than a normal set of nested conditions, as there are likely to be several departments I would use a Switch which is a type of condition that looks at just one answer and can have up to 27 "cases" - in case department Payments is selected then add item to Payments list.
